The morning after the game, Lauko was quick to go to X, comparing himself to Gothmog from Lord of The Rings.
Lauko is a self-described Lord of The Rings super fan. He even got a tattoo of a quote on his left arm.
The winger took the skate to face Tuesday night when Chicago's Jason Dickinson inadvertently clipped him as he was falling near the boards. Lauko immediately threw off his gloves and reached for his face as he skated off the ice quickly. Luckily for him, his eye was spared as the skate sliced him just milliliters away.
The Bruins will take on the Anaheim Ducks Thursday. We will have to see if Lauko is in the lineup, or if head coach Jim Montgomery will give him the night off to recover.
